The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of William Newman, born in 1853 in Bottisham, Cambridgeshire, consisted of 5 members. William was the head of the household, married to Alice Newman, born in 1854 in Stow cum Quy, Cambridgeshire, England. They had 2 children; William (born 1878 in Stow cum Quy, Cambridgeshire, England) and Annie Maria (born 1880 in Bingley, Yorkshire, England).
During the period, also present in the household was William's Sister In Law, Mary Ann Ison, born in 1856 in Stow cum Quy, Cambridgeshire, England.
